Information about Crowder State Park will be shared by staff during a public meeting on Saturday, Aug. 25 at the campground amphitheater.
The meeting will be from 7 to 8 p.m., with updates given about current and future plans for the park. Those attending will also be able to make comments.
A “spider sniff” will take place following the meeting, beginning at 8:30 p.m. at the amphitheater. Staff will present information about spiders found in Missouri, followed by a short hike. Those attending should wear closed-toe shoes and insect repellant as well as bring a flashlight.
